§ 3-901. Definitions

(a) In this subtitle the following terms have the meanings indicated.
(b) “Child” means a legitimate or an illegitimate child.
(c) “Parent” includes the mother and father of a deceased illegitimate child.
(d) “Person” includes an individual, receiver, trustee, guardian, executor, administrator, fiduciary, or representative of any kind, or any partnership, firm, association, public or private corporation, or any other entity.
(e) “Wrongful act” means an act, neglect, or default including a felonious act which would have entitled the party injured to maintain an action and recover damages if death had not ensued.
